Do’s And Don’ts In Case Of Water Damage
Water offers life, water breach on components where it's not supposed to be can result in damage. It can peel away surface areas as well as deteriorate the structure if the water saturates right into your framework. Mold and mildew as well as mold likewise thrive in a moist setting, which can be unsafe for your wellness. Residences with water damages smell stuffy and old.

Water can originate from numerous resources such as tropical cyclones, floodings, ruptured pipelines, leakages, as well as sewer concerns. In case you experience water damage, it would certainly be great to know some security precautions. Below are a couple of standards on exactly how to handle water damages.

 

 

Do Prioritize Residence Insurance Coverage Insurance Coverage



Water damages from flooding because of heavy winds is seasonal. You can additionally experience an abrupt flooding when a malfunctioning pipe all of a sudden breaks right into your home. It would certainly be best to have house insurance policy that covers both disasters such as all-natural tragedies, and emergencies like busted plumbing.

 

 

Do Not Fail To Remember to Shut Off Utilities



In case of a catastrophe, particularly if you live in a flood-prone location, it would certainly be advisable to shut off the primary electrical circuit. This cuts off power to your entire house, avoiding electrical shocks when water comes in as it is a conductor. Don't forget to transform off the primary water line valve. Furnishings will relocate around and also trigger damage when floodwaters are high. Having the main valve shut down prevents more damages.

 

 

Do Remain Proactive and Heed Weather Condition Signals



Storm floodings can be extremely unforeseeable. Remain ready as well as proactive if there is a history of flooding in your area. If you live near a lake, creek, or river , listen to discharge cautions. Get belongings from the first stage and cellar, after that placed them on the greatest feasible level. Doing so reduces potential home damage.

 

 

Do Not Overlook the Roofing System



You can prevent rainfall damage if there are no openings as well as leaks in your roof. This will certainly protect against water from streaming down your wall surfaces and also saturating your ceiling.

 

 

Do Take Notice Of Tiny Leakages



A burst pipe doesn't take place overnight. Usually, there are warnings that suggest you have compromised pipelines in your house. For instance, you may observe bubbling paint, peeling off wallpaper, water streaks, water discolorations, or leaking sounds behind the wall surfaces. Ultimately, this pipeline will certainly burst. Preferably, you ought to not await things to escalate. Have your plumbing fixed prior to it causes substantial damages.

 

 

Don't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ipeline



Maintaining your clearheadedness is crucial in a time of situation. Stressing will just worsen the trouble due to the fact that it will certainly stifle you from acting fast. Timing is crucial when it comes to water damage. The longer you wait, the even more damages you can expect. Hence, if a pipeline bursts in your home, immediately shut down your primary water valve to remove the resource. Then disconnect all electric outlets in the area or switch off the breaker for that part of the house. Call a credible water damage reconstruction expert for aid.

Water Damage Do and Don'ts

 

Water damage at your home or commercial property is a serious problem. You will need assistance from a professional plumber and a water damage restoration agency to get things back in order. While you are waiting for help to arrive, however, there are some things you should do to make the situation better. Likewise, there are things you absolutely shoud not do because they will only make things worse.



 

DO these things to improve your situation

 

Get some ventilation going. Open up your doors, your windows, your cabinets – everything. Don’t let anything remain closed. Your aim here is to expose as much surface area to air as possible in order to quicken the drying out process. Use fans if you have them, but only if they’re plugged into a part of the house that’s not currently underwater.

 

Remove as much standing water as you can. Do this by using mops, sponges and clean white towels. However, it’s important that you don’t push or wipe the water. Simply use blotting motions to soak it up. Wiping or pushing could result in the water getting pushed deeper into your home or carpeting and increasing your problem.

 

Turn off the power to the soaked areas. You will want to remove the danger of electrocution from the water-logged area to do some cleaning and to help the plumber and the restoration agents do their work.


Move any furniture and belongings from the affected room to a safe and dry area. Taking your possessions to a dry place will make it easier to decide which need restoring and repair. It will also prevent your belongings from being exposed to further moisture.

 

DON’T do any of these things for any reason

 

Don’t use your vacuum cleaner to suck up the water. This will not only get you electrocuted, but will also severely damage your vacuum cleaner. Use manual means of water removal, like with mops and pails.


Don’t use newspaper to soak up the water. The ink they use for newsprint runs and transfers very easily, which could then stain carpet and tile with hard-to-remove stains.


Don’t disturb mold. This is especially true if you spot a severe growth. Leave the mold remediation efforts to the professionals. Attempting to clean it yourself could mean exposing yourself to the harmful health effects of mold. Worse, you could inadvertently spread it to other areas of the house.


Don’t turn on your HVAC system until given approval from the restoration agency. Turning your HVAC system on before everything has been cleaned could spread moisture and mold all over the house.
